The purpose and objectives of the project:

The project is primarily aimed at addressing the shortage of school institutions and contributing to the improvement of the quality of secondary education in the city of Kosshy.

The assessment of the need has been provided by local authorities, as outlined in the letter requesting the construction of the school.

The stakeholders identified include students from Kosshy and the regional educational authorities.

Quality: Compliance with construction, safety, and seismic standards.

Quantity: The building spans 16,000 square meters and can accommodate at least 1,500 students per shift.

Implementation of the project:

The ‘construction and handover’ approach involves transferring the school to local executive bodies for proper functioning and operation.

1) Design; 2) Construction; 3) Expertise; 4) Equipment; 5) Commissioning.

The project cost is 7,900,000,000 tenge.

Ten employees are involved in the project, and no volunteers were engaged. The project took 1.5 years from concept to operation. The beneficiaries-pupils were engaged through surveys to capture their primary needs, alongside those of the residents. Educational authorities were involved in the project from the design phase to commissioning.

Results:

Objectives have been achieved at 100%.

Assessing impact is not currently feasible, as the school will commence operation on 1st September 2023

The start of construction, as well as the progress and significant adjustments to the project, were covered in various media outlets, on the website, and on the Foundation’s social media platforms.

On the Foundation’s social media channels, posts about the school reflect beneficiaries’ opinions about the project. Additionally, beneficiaries’ opinions will be featured on the Foundation’s social media pages from September 1st to September 15th, after the start of operation.

The project’s sustainability is ensured through transferring the school to the local executive bodies, which in turn guarantees the project’s sustainability for at least 50 years with proper building maintenance. An SROI assessment can be conducted as the school begins its operation.
